Minutes — Management Meeting, Orvane Holdings

Present: R. Calloway, M. Brisk, T. Ondal.

Agreed: divest the Ferrowick tooling unit by Q3. Valuation range accepted as presented. Legal to draft term sheet; HR to prepare retention plan for key staff. Incoming director to own buyer negotiations from next week. No external communication until signatures. Further context for the incoming director is set out below.

confidential, kagup-bafog: Fraaxax Group is in early talks to buy Soroxox Group for about $343.8 million. The Olidor launch date is June 14, and nothing goes to the press before then. Legal wants the Aldmirek Logistics term sheet signed before July 23.

Handover: Exportron retry queue

Hi Mira — handing over the failed-export retries. Exports that hit a timeout land in the retry queue and get three attempts with backoff; after that they're parked and need a manual requeue from the admin panel. Watch for customers reporting duplicates — that usually means a double requeue. The current retry settings are as follows.

settings of bajog-fawig:
oliael:
  log_level: warn
  metrics_host: metrics.oliael.zemvarsys.internal
  pin: 0267
  pool_size: 32

## Build Provenance: Notification Fan-out Backpressure

When the Quillbarn provenance service emits attestations faster than subscribers drain them, the fan-out queue applies backpressure and delays webhook delivery. This is expected; do not restart the emitter. Check queue depth on the Larkspur dashboard before escalating. The last healthy build observed under backpressure is recorded below.

pipeline stamp: htk4_ae36

Subject: CSV Import Wizard — new build going out today

Hi all (and welcome to the new folks on Tablecraft!), we're shipping an update to the CSV import wizard this afternoon. Main changes: better delimiter sniffing and a clearer error when headers are duplicated. Nothing scary, but keep an eye on support tickets through tomorrow. For anyone verifying the rollout, the build token is below.

pipeline stamp: htk6_35e0c9